Koh Khai

Koh Khai, also known as Chicken Island, is a group of small islands located in the Andaman Sea off the coast of Thailand. Part of the Krabi province, these islands are a popular destination for tourists due to their stunning beaches and crystal clear waters.

There are three main islands in the Koh Khai group: Koh Khai Nai, Koh Khai Nok, and Koh Khai Nui. Each island has its own unique charm and offers a variety of activities for visitors, such as swimming, snorkeling, and sunbathing. The beaches on Koh Khai Nai and Koh Khai Nok are particularly popular due to their fine sandy shores and clear water.

In addition to its beautiful beaches, Koh Khai is also known for its coral reef, which is home to a wide variety of marine life including colorful fish, sea turtles, and dolphins. The crystal clear waters make it a great spot for snorkeling and diving. Kayaking is also a popular activity on these islands, with several rental companies offering guided tours of the surrounding area.

Despite its small size, Koh Khai has a number of restaurants and food stalls that serve traditional Thai food. Visitors can try local specialties such as tom yum soup, pad Thai, and coconut curry.

How to get to Koh Khai

There are several ways to get to Koh Khai from Thailand:

  • By plane: The nearest airport to Koh Khai is the Phuket International Airport, which is located about 50 km away from the island. From the airport, you can take a taxi or hire a private car to take you to the ferry terminal, where you can catch a ferry to Koh Khai.
  • By ferry: The ferry terminal in Phuket is located at Rassada Pier, which is about 30 km from Phuket Town. From the pier, you can catch a ferry to Koh Khai. The ferry ride takes about 15 minutes.
  • By private boat: If you prefer to travel in style, you can hire a private boat to take you to Koh Khai. This option is more expensive, but it allows you to have more flexibility and control over your travel itinerary.
  • By speedboat: Another option is to take a speedboat from Phuket to Koh Khai. This is a faster option than the ferry, but it is also more expensive.
  • By bus: If you’re coming from Bangkok or another city in Thailand, you can take a bus to Phuket and then transfer to a ferry or speedboat to Koh Khai.

It is easy to get to Koh Khai, as most tour companies offer half-day or full-day tours of the island. These tours often include kayaking and other activities, and can be booked through your hotel or through a local travel agency. Simply ask at your hotel counter or visit a street travel agent to find a tour that fits your needs and preferences.
